THE SMART TRICK OF SLUGGERS CHICAGO THAT NO ONE IS DISCUSSING

The smart Trick of sluggers chicago That No One is Discussing

With in excess of 40 TVs which includes excellent sight traces to 6 10 foot huge screens and correctly put High definition TVs all over the bar, there is no improved area to watch a Chicago, let alone ANY, sporting celebration. With a lot of memorabilia and memories covering the partitions, our entire bar, comprehensive beer record, and common dri

read more